#23634d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#23634d is composed of 13.7% red, 38.8%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.2%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 159.4 degrees, a saturation of 47.8% and a lightness of 26.3%. #23634d color hex could be obtained by blending #46c69a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#23634d color description : Very dark cyan - lime green.
#23634d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#23634d has RGB values of R:35, G:99,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.22,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 2319181.
